The Wheeler F.A.T. Wrench (Firearms Accurizing Torque) is a handheld torque driver built for applying accurate, repeatable torque settings to scope rings, base screws, and other precision firearm fasteners. Engineered by Wheeler Engineering, this bench tool helps gunsmiths and shooters avoid the over- and under-tightening that can shift optics, stress a scope tube, or crack a base.
Adjustment is straightforward: a click-stop range covers 10-65 in-lbs in 0.5 in-lb increments, and a standard 1/4" drive accepts common screwdriver bits so you can swap tips for different screw heads. The internal mechanism carries a black phosphate coating for corrosion resistance, while the signature black-and-yellow plastic housing is comfortable in the hand and easy to read at the bench.
At roughly 0.50 lbs, the F.A.T. Wrench is light enough to live in a range bag yet well-suited to the most common torque jobs in scope mounting, action work, and gunsmithing setups. Per Wheeler's documentation, common uses include installing scope ring screws and any small fastener where repeatable, accurate torque matters.
